A scalp exfoliation brush is a specialized hair styling tool designed to gently remove dead skin cells, product buildup, and excess oil from the scalp. This brush promotes a healthier scalp environment, enhancing hair growth and overall hair health.

FAQs
What is a scalp exfoliation brush used for?
A scalp exfoliation brush is used to remove dead skin cells, product buildup, and excess oil from the scalp, promoting a healthier environment for hair growth.
How often should I use a scalp exfoliation brush?
It's recommended to use a scalp exfoliation brush once a week or as needed, depending on your scalp's condition and product usage.
Can a scalp exfoliation brush help with dandruff?
Yes, a scalp exfoliation brush can help reduce dandruff by removing flakes and buildup, promoting a healthier scalp.
Is it safe to use a scalp exfoliation brush on sensitive skin?
Yes, but it's important to use gentle pressure and choose a brush with soft bristles to avoid irritation.
What type of shampoo should I use with a scalp exfoliation brush?
A clarifying shampoo is ideal to use with a scalp exfoliation brush, as it helps to thoroughly cleanse the scalp and enhance the exfoliating process.
